Output 59c6326153d46c072481f5d200be3cdf775c9261abcd481350c69adc3a54b62a:1

value
2520005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97763a3376d45188f963e7a51e5e0cef125f4408 OP_EQUAL
address
3FVsb6Bxoy6SKcZ4muW4qXPCQj23WdNKpg
transaction
59c6326153d46c072481f5d200be3cdf775c9261abcd481350c69adc3a54b62a
spent
true